1. Why Does Deferred Maintenance Drive Up Your Utility Bills in Hadley Homes?

A clogged dryer vent forces your appliance to work twice as long to expel moisture, directly spiking your monthly electricity or gas bills. In historic farmhouses and newer residential developments across areas/hadley-ma/, long vent runs with multiple 90-degree elbows frequently trap dense layers of lint. When air cannot circulate freely, drying cycles double from 45 minutes to over an hour and a half, burning unnecessary energy. Furthermore, restricted airflow overheats your dryer's heating element, leading to premature thermal fuse failures and costly appliance repairs. 2. How Do Transparent Pricing Models Protect You From Hidden Fees?

Transparent pricing is a baseline requirement when searching for budget-friendly upkeep, ensuring you never face surprise charges upon job completion. Many low-ball contractors quote a rock-bottom base rate over the phone, only to tack on expensive fees for roof terminations, extra-long duct runs, or heavy lint compaction once they arrive on-site. When comparing local options, always ask if bird guard removal, transition hose checks, and multi-story roof vent clearances are factored into the initial quote. 3. What Are the Real Dangers of Postponing Your Annual Lint Extraction?

A dryer vent inspection is a specialized diagnostic evaluation of your exhaust system's structural integrity, airflow velocity, and lint accumulation levels. Postponing this vital service creates an immediate fire hazard inside your laundry room. According to federal fire safety data, thousands of residential fires ignite annually due to accumulated lint blocking dryer exhaust channels. Beyond the severe combustion risk the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ency advises managing indoor air quality factors that can be compromised by trapped moisture and mold. When moist air fails to vent outside, it seeps into your wall cavities, encouraging mold growth and wood rot in New England's humid summer months. Frequently Asked Questions

How does affordable dryer vent cleaning in Hadley, MA differ from cheap discount services?

Affordable service balances fair, transparent pricing with thorough, professional-grade tools like rotary brushes and high-powered vacuums. Cheap discount services often rely on hidden fees, incomplete cleaning of long duct runs, and untrained labor that leaves dangerous lint blockages behind.

What factors influence the cost of professional dryer vent cleaning for homes near Belchertown?

Cost is primarily determined by the physical length of the duct run, the number of 90-degree elbows, whether the vent exits through the roof or ground-floor side wall, and the degree of lint compaction inside the pipe.

How often should Hadley and Belchertown homeowners schedule professional vent cleaning?

Most residential dryer vents should be professionally cleaned at least once a year. Households with large families, heavy pet ownership, or extra-long vent configurations may require semi-annual service to maintain peak airflow and safety.

Can I perform a complete dryer vent cleaning myself to save money?

While cleaning the lint trap and short accessible transition hoses is great for DIY upkeep, DIY kits lack the reach and suction needed for multi-story or long home duct runs. Incomplete DIY cleaning can pack lint tighter, creating a severe fire hazard.
